WebAs women across the world have made strides towards gender equality in the last century, Buddhist women and their male allies have worked to uproot gender discrimination in their communities. Buddhist women founded an international association, Sakyadhita, in 1987 “to benefit Buddhist women [and] reduce gender injustice.”.
